Ground states energies of helium-isoelectric series
Description
Ground state energies of helium - isoelectric series: He, Li+, B++, B+3 and C+4 were calculated by considering that the repulsive Coulomb interaction energy between the two electrons is described by the form 1/r12 only to a closely resemblance distance 2 R, and a constant potential within this distance. The results of calculations are in good agreement with the exact results of Pekeris. (author)
